hibernate-basic

hibernate-101, basic coding function like CRUD operation with details steps. The Purpose of this project is to understand hibernate with simple and live example.

Feature:

This is basic Java Hibernate project where we have used a table called Student. and we enter and manupulate DB table data by using this code.

Steps to Configure Project:

  1. Open folder "starter_db_files/"
  2. Open your MySql Workbench
  3. open sql file "starter_db_files/01-create-user.sql", to create new user account. If you wish to use your own credentials then you need to change in code.
  4. Open "starter_db_files/02-student-tracker.sql", this will create Student Table.
  5. Next Open Eclipse IDE installed in your system.
  6. Import the Project in to you system.
  7. Need to add Lib jar into classpath, those Jar files are provided under following folder: "lib".
  8. Now right click on project root in Eclipse, and go to properties.
  9. Select "Java Build Path" and the select tab "Libraries"
  10. Click on "Add JARs..." button and got to project based "lib" folder and select the all the jar files and add., 'Apply and Close'
  11. Run the project

Explore Project:

All the application are avaiable under package named "crudops".

CRUD ops details :
  • CreateStudentsForPrimarykeyDemo.java --> For Create Operation
  • DeleteStudent.java --> For Delete Operation
  • GetStudent.java --> For Read Operation
  • UpdateStudent.java --> For Update Operation
  • UpdateBulkStudent.java --> For Bulk Update Operations using Custom Query object
  • HBQueryingStudentDemo.java --> Example of using Custom Query Object
